ResurFX is a popular non-ablative fractional laser treatment designed to improve skin texture, reduce the appearance of scars, and address various skin conditions. While it is generally considered safe, as with any medical procedure, there are potential risks associated with ResurFX treatments in Hobart.
One of the primary risks is the possibility of side effects such as redness, swelling, and mild discomfort, which are usually temporary and resolve within a few days. However, in some cases, more severe side effects can occur, including infection, hyperpigmentation, or hypopigmentation. These risks can be minimized by choosing a qualified and experienced practitioner who follows proper sterilization and treatment protocols.
Another consideration is the individual's skin type and condition. Patients with certain skin conditions or those taking specific medications may be at a higher risk for complications. It is crucial to have a thorough consultation with a healthcare professional to assess your suitability for the treatment and to discuss any potential risks.
In summary, while ResurFX can offer significant benefits for skin rejuvenation, it is essential to be aware of the potential risks and to ensure that the treatment is performed by a qualified professional in Hobart.

Personalized Consultation: A Crucial Step
Before undergoing ResurFX treatment, it is imperative to have a thorough consultation with a qualified dermatologist or cosmetic surgeon. This consultation is essential for assessing your skin type, current health status, and any medications you may be taking. Certain skin conditions, such as active acne or recent sunburn, can increase the risk of complications. Similarly, medications that affect skin healing, such as corticosteroids or blood thinners, need to be carefully evaluated.

Common Side Effects
One of the most frequently reported side effects of ResurFX is temporary redness and swelling, which typically resolve within a few hours to a couple of days. Some patients may also experience mild discomfort during the procedure, which can be managed with topical anesthetics. It is crucial to follow your practitioner's post-treatment care instructions to minimize these side effects.
Potential Complications
While rare, more serious complications can occur. These include hyperpigmentation, where the skin becomes darker in the treated area, and hypopigmentation, where the skin lightens. These conditions can be temporary or permanent, depending on individual skin type and the expertise of the practitioner. Additionally, there is a small risk of infection, which can be mitigated by ensuring the treatment is performed in a sterile environment.
